Here are five things to know:
1. There are two platforms — the TytoHome for patients and TytoPro for clinicians.
2. The patients use TytoHome to perform a medical exam. They can share results with their physician.
3. TytoPro captures the digital exam data from patients. The data can integrate with patient health records and physicians can share the data with the patient’s other specialists.
4. The company also launched digital tools that integrate the telehealth platform for heart, lung, heart rate, temperature, throat, skin and ear examinations.
5. The company aims to replicate the in-office physical exam experience at home.
